我的Web应用程序将URL段存储在数据库中。这些URL片段基于用户提交的内容。对于将出现在URL中的字符串,我应该使用什么排序规则?我的假设是ASCIIGeneralCI(?)基于这个问题:WhichcharactersmakeaURLinvalid? 最佳答案 据我所知,这并不重要。URL中的有效字符以我知道的任何字符集表示,我不会在表和列之间使用不同的排序规则——在任何尝试加入它们或执行任何其他操作时,你都会遇到“非法排序规则混合”问题一种跨列或跨表操作(参见我最近的问题here)。当然,如果我错了,请纠正我。
我正在尝试扩展mysqli类以创建一个辅助类,该类将抽象出一些复杂性。我想要完成的主要事情之一是利用准备好的语句。我真的不知道从哪里开始,或者如何在一个类中正确处理输入和输出。另一个问题是我无法在使用准备语句时将数据输出为数组。我真的可以用一个简单的例子来指明正确的方向。 最佳答案 查看Zend_Db的实现,特别是Zend_Db_Select.事实上,您可能只是选择使用它而不是开发自己的。示例://connecttoadatabaseusingthemysqliadapter//forlistofothersupportedadap
我需要知道如何使用适当的SQL标准在MYSQL中计算具有特定纬度和经度的所需半径或距离?我在互联网上找到了很多解决方案,但他们花了很多时间,他们涉及cos和其他条款。请帮忙! 最佳答案 看看这个链接。这可能对你有帮助。CalculateDistance. 关于php-如何使用适当的SQL标准在MYSQL中计算具有特定纬度和经度的所需半径或距离?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/ques
我有一个相对较大的4-deep关系数据设置,如下所示:ClientApplicationhas_many=>ClientApplicationVersionsClientApplicationVersionshas_many=>CloudLogsCloudLogshas_many=>Logsclient_applications:(可能有1,000条记录)-...-account_id-public_key-deleted_atclient_application_versions:(可能有10,000条记录)-...-client_application_id-public_key-
我正在尝试将Google的云存储与我的iOS应用程序一起使用,经过数小时的头痛和滚动之后,我终于能够将GTL库添加到我的项目中。我不明白为什么他们不能把它做成“Google.framework”之类的东西,实际上我不得不下载一个示例项目,然后抓取文件。我在我的应用程序中添加了Objective-CGoogle服务“Storage”,但我找不到任何关于如何使用它来将文件上传到我的云存储的文档。我为Objective-C找到的唯一文档是this,它只显示了非常有限的示例,并且缺少很多信息。正如我所说,我正在尝试将文件上传到我的Google云存储,但此“文档”中唯一提到的“上传文件”是使用G
我写了一个thriftIDL,如下所示:structProduct{1:stringname,2:stringdescription}发布这个IDL后,我注意到“描述”在iOS中是一种“保留”,因为NSObject类有'description'classmethod这个IDL应该在iOS中使用。我已经考虑过这个话题并得到了一些候选人:细节详细信息详细文本描述文字但由于我的母语不是英语,所以我不知道哪一个最好(就自然性和简洁性而言)。我理解命名事物取决于它的域区域,但我敢肯定,对某物的“描述”是很常见的概念,并且许多iOS开发者都对NSObject这件事感到困惑。
我正在尝试将我自己的图像添加为条形按钮项目,但我不知道如何使图像正确缩放。Apple的人机界面指南建议我的图像为44x44像素,但是当我使用44x44像素的图像时,它对于工具栏来说太大了,如您所见:当我使用较小版本的图像时,它在Retina显示屏上看起来像素化。我应该在这里做什么? 最佳答案 在images.xcassets中,您可以将图像添加为1x、2x和3x。Xcode将根据设备使用适当的图像大小。 关于iOS:如何为条形按钮项目设置适当的图像比例,我们在StackOverflow上
我正在尝试获取属性字符串的高度。这按预期工作:[attrStringboundingRectWithSize:sizeoptions:(NSStringDrawingUsesLineFragmentOrigin|NSStringDrawingTruncatesLastVisibleLine)context:NULL]...除非字符串包含表情符号。使用表情符号时,字符串会在标签底部被截断。我需要做什么特别的事情吗? 最佳答案 我知道这是一篇旧文章,但有人可能仍然觉得它有用,您可以转到核心文本,让它为您完成艰苦的工作!staticinl
我们有一个服务器来为我们的API提供服务。我已经使用它一段时间了,现在我正在经历我现在所说的一种从我们的API服务器到某些目的地的服务器偏见(对某些发件人好,对其他发件人不好)我想知道到底发生了什么。一些请求正在通过TCP重置(RST)进行响应,但其他请求确实得到正确响应(200状态,预期内容)。我想澄清的是,这并不是在服务器中明确完成的(我们实际上并没有选择要拒绝的目的地),而且对于我尝试过的每个客户端,我总是得到相同的结果(我的意思是,行为是确定性的,仅取决于发件人-至少表面上如此)。这是我发送的实际请求:GET/api/guilherme@buddycloud.org/metad
注意Swift正在swift变化,这个问题是关于:Xcode7,Swift2.0解释我希望实现一个通用的返回参数。很多时候,我发现有必要实现一个可选的版本重载,这样我就可以访问底层类型并适本地处理它。这是一些制造的功能。String的赋值只是作为复制的占位符:funcambiguous()->T{letthing="asdf"returnthingas!T}funcambiguous()->T?{returnnil}现在,如果我们看一下实现://Fineleta:String=ambiguous()//Ambiguousletb:String?=ambiguous()这看起来很明显,因